In this new year's edition of The Scottish Football Citizen we take a trip back to Ne'erday 1973. Andy Kerr takes a trip to Tynecastle for the traditional new year derby match as Bobby Seith's Hearts take on Eddie Turnbull's swashbuckling Hibs. Robert Harvey then takes us over to Glasgow for another derby on the same day as he made his first-team debut for Clyde at Hampden against Queen's Park in the second division.
